Proper setup and ongoing care are fundamental to the performance of any mechanical component. For a Cylinder Earring Bearing, often recognised by its distinct cylindrical housing and mounting ears, adherence to correct installation and maintenance routines directly influences its operational lifespan and reliability. This guide outlines practical steps and considerations to ensure these bearings function as intended.

Before mounting begins, a few checks can prevent common issues. Confirm that the bearing model aligns with your application's requirements, paying particular attention to the shaft diameter. Inspect both the shaft and the mounting surface for any dirt, burrs, or damage that could affect fit or alignment. Clean these surfaces thoroughly. Ensure all necessary parts are present, including locking devices like set screws or eccentric collars, washers, and mounting bolts. Having the correct tools ready streamlines the process.
A methodical approach to installation supports smooth operation. Start by sliding the bearing onto the shaft to its designated position. The next step involves securing the inner ring to the shaft. If using a set screw, tighten it firmly to the manufacturer's specification, ensuring it contacts a flat spot on the shaft if one is provided. For bearings with an eccentric locking collar, follow the specific instructions for rotation and tightening to achieve a secure hold. Once the bearing is fixed on the shaft, position the entire unit and align the holes in the bearing's mounting ears with those in the frame or base. Insert and gradually tighten the mounting bolts in a crisscross pattern to ensure the housing sits flat without distortion. Finally, perform a manual rotation of the shaft to check for smooth, unobstructed movement.
A functional aspect of many Cylinder Earring Bearings is their built-in capacity for self-alignment. This design allows the bearing to accommodate minor angular misalignment between the shaft and the housing. It is useful to perform a final alignment check of the connected components before fully tightening all mounting bolts. This practice lets the bearing naturally adjust to its optimal position, reducing internal stress and supporting even load distribution.
Consistent care following installation helps maintain bearing condition. Regular lubrication is necessary; use the type of grease specified for the application and operating environment. Apply grease through the fitting until a slight purge is seen at the seal, clearing out old lubricant and contaminants. Avoid over-greasing, as this can cause overheating. Establish a routine to inspect the bearing for signs of seal degradation, unusual noise during operation, or any looseness in the mounting bolts. Keeping the area around the bearing clear of excessive debris and moisture also contributes to sustained performance.
The service life of a Cylinder Earring Bearing is closely tied to how it is installed and maintained. Following structured procedures for mounting, taking advantage of its alignment features, and committing to a regular maintenance schedule are practical ways to support dependable operation. These actions help manage wear and can extend the intervals between servicing, contributing to consistent machinery function.
